You’ve got about 2.5 seconds to tell a visitor two things before they hit the back button:  >> What you do and where you do it "Documenting Love & Light" tells them zip, zilch, nada… It’s poetic and makes ya' feel warm and fuzzy... but it won't move the needle.  Google’s search bots are crawling your website looking for you to tell it something specific.  You can’t make them guess at what you do and where you do it. You gotta' be literal.  When you use a vague headline, you’re basically telling Google, "I don’t want to be found by people in my city looking for my photography services." Here’s exactly what you’re gonna’ do instead: Let's pretend you're a wedding photographer from Nashville who specializes in micro weddings. Go to your homepage right now.  Find your H1 tag (that’s your *main* headline... the most important one).  Change it to a power headline that follows this stupid simple formula: 👇 [Where You Are] + [What You Are] + [Who You’re For] Instead of "Capturing Love & Light"... Try this on: "A Nashville Wedding Photographer for Couples Who Want an Intimate, Micro Wedding." - Now, Google knows you’re in Nashville... -It also knows you do Micro Weddings...  -And it knows *exactly who* to show your site to. Your website shouldn't just be something that looks pretty and makes people feel warm n’ fuzzy.  It should be a lead-generation machine that works while you're eating, sleeping or out doing what you do best.
